Output 56ac0182151ce63198d6c996ed5b9495787db5ea1e4695a9c7a33bf2f477a538:26

value
10952836
script pubkey
OP_0 OP_PUSHBYTES_20 89d64fb61238cca524af48d28b87e0eedf3fc392
address
bc1q38tyldsj8rx22f90frfghplqam0nlsuj2y7d56
transaction
56ac0182151ce63198d6c996ed5b9495787db5ea1e4695a9c7a33bf2f477a538
spent
true